Yanmar Acquires CLAAS India
Yanmar Co. Ltd.
The move, through its group company Yanmar Coromandel Agrisolutions, is expected to be completed in September 2024 and includes all shares of CLAAS India, manufacturer of agricultural machinery in India.

John Deere Introduces E-Drive 744 & 824 X-Tier Wheel Loaders
Deere & Company
Both new models feature the John Deere Electric Variable Transmission (EVT) E-Drive system and a quieter cab environment attributed to the constant engine speed.
